Budget Cuts Would Decimate EPA’s Energy Star—An Energy Efficiency Program That Has Saved Consumers and Businesses $430 Billion in Energy Costs

Old energy meters on side of building

Energy Star has saved Americans $430 billion on energy costs, helping consumers identify the most energy efficient products. Cutting back this program would impact innovation, consumers, and companies, as the Energy Star program has pushed companies to strive for leadership in energy efficiency.
